Strong's #11: Abraam (pronounced ab-rah-am')

of Hebrew origin (85); Abraham, the Hebrew patriarch:--Abraham. (In Acts 7:16 the text should probably read Jacob.)




Thayer's Greek Lexicon:

̓́

Abraam

Abraham = "father of a multitude"

1) the son of Terah and the founder of the Jewish nation

Part of Speech: proper noun masculine

Relation: of Hebrew origin H85
